Eagle Flag verifies Kentucky Air Guard's ability to deploy and establish JTF-PO
Tech. Sgt. Jeremy Hitt, a vehicle operator from the 22nd Logistics Readiness Squadron at McConnell Air Force Base, Kan., straps cargo to a flatbed trailer March 29, 2012, at Joint Base McGuire-Dix-Lakehurst, N.J. Hitt was working at the Forward Node of a Joint Task Force-Port Opening during Eagle Flag, a U.S. Air Force-sponsored exercise to prepare units for operating in deployed environments. The Kentucky Air National Guard's 123rd Contingency Response Group operated the airlift side of the JTF-PO, known as an Aerial Port of Debarkation. (U.S. Air Force photo by Maj. Dale Greer)
